篔 · yún
Yun — refers to a type of large bamboo with thick joints, often found in classical Chinese literature.

Cultural background
FAQ- 篔 is a classical term for a specific type of large bamboo, often associated with scholarly elegance and natural beauty in Chinese literature.
- The character appears in classical poetry and prose, evoking images of lush bamboo groves and refined natural settings.
- In naming contexts, it carries connotations of resilience, elegance, and scholarly refinement due to bamboo's cultural significance.
